2026-01-09 23:28:51
在创建区块链平台构架图之前,我们需要理解区块链的核心概念。区块链是一个去中心化的分布式账本技术,它确保了数据的透明性、不可篡改性和安全性。每个数据块都包含了一定数量的交易信息,并通过密码学方法连接到前一个区块,这样形成了链条。
区块链技术通常由以下几个核心组件构成:
制作区块链平台构架图有几步关键操作,下面详细介绍:
在开始绘制构架图之前,首先要明确区块链平台的目标。例如,你是为了解决某一行业的问题还是提供特定的服务?需要与哪些外部系统集成?明确这些问题后,可以为构架图建立清晰的基础。
根据目标和需求,识别区块链平台中的核心组件。这些可以包括:节点类型、合约、共识机制、存储结构、网络拓扑等。每个组件的角色和功能在图中需要充分展示。
构架图不仅要展示静态组件,还需要展示数据的流动方向。例如,当用户发起交易时,数据是如何在网络中传播的?共识机制是如何被触发的?这些数据流动的路径将使构架图更具可操作性。
选择合适的工具可以帮助提高构架图的可视化效果。一些常用的绘图工具包括 Microsoft Visio、Lucidchart、Draw.io 等。使用这些工具能够清晰地绘制出各种形状、线条以及标签,从而使构架图更加生动、易懂。
完成初步构架图后,建议提交给团队成员进行反馈。集思广益可能会让你发现遗漏的部分或更好的设计思路。数据安全、可扩展性及用户体验等方面的反馈都是至关重要的。
在收集到反馈后,进行相应的调整与,最终确认构架图。最后,要确保所有相关的文档都已更新,帮助后续的开发和实施。
节点是区块链技术中特别重要的部分,其分类通常取决于节点的功能和所需的资源。主要有三种类型:
每种节点在构架图中的功能和交互关系都需要清晰展示,以便后续的开发人员能更容易地理解整体系统架构。
共识机制是区块链平台的核心,选择适合的共识机制对于系统的安全性、效率和可扩展性都有着重要影响。主要可选择以下几种机制:
在选择共识机制时,可依据平台的特定需求、网络规模和用户个体的资源来做综合性考量。有些情况下,甚至可以考虑混合机制,以提升系统的灵活性与安全性。
智能合约为区块链应用的关键组成部分,允许自动执行合约条款。其适用场景非常广泛,如下:
智能合约的强大之处在于其自动化的执行能力,这使得许多传统行业能实现更高效的工作流程,减少人力干预和错误发生的风险。
安全性是区块链平台不可忽视的方面,确保平台安全需要从多方面入手:
总之,确保区块链平台的安全性是一个系统化的过程,只有在设计、开发以及运营的各个阶段都高度重视安全,才能在面对不断变换的网络环境中更好地保护用户和系统的安全。
总体来说,制作一个完善的区块链平台构架图涉及到从需求分析、组件识别到数据流动设计等多个方面,最后通过团队反馈来不断迭代和。准确、清晰的构架图不仅能够为后续实施提供指导,也能帮助与利益相关者沟通,实现项目目标。希望以上内容对你理解和制作区块链平台构架图有所帮助。